The following datasheet gives an overviewof AISI 52100 alloy steel. AISI 52100 steel is the representative of high carbon chromium bearing steel type. In the annealed condition 52100 is comparatively easy to machine, however very high hardness and abrasion resistance can be achieved through heat treatment, along with high levels of tensile and fatigue strength. And it also can be called ISO 100Cr6 steel, GB GCr15 steel. Its wear-resistance and fatigue strength are high and with good combination properties. The steel has been around since 1905, has been known as 52100 since 1919, and has been used in knives since at least the 1940’s. AISI 52100 alloy steel is annealed at 872°C (1600°F) followed by slowly cooling to reduce cold working or machining stress.
